Beyond the first day of … Web23 Nov 2024 · Clinical advice on how to treat new mothers with sepsis could change after two women died of a postpartum herpesvirus infection. The Royal College of Obstetricians and Gynaecologists said viral infections must routinely be considered as a possible cause of postpartum infection.
WebPostpartum, she became persistently febrile and developed transaminitis, symptomatic hypotension, and pancytopenia despite antibiotics. Imaging revealed acute liver injury, splenomegaly, pleural effusions, and cardiomyopathy. Serum polymerase chain reaction (PCR) screening identified HSV-1 infection. The patient recovered on acyclovir.
